>  기사  >  데이터 베이스  >  MySQL이 내부 명령이 아닌 이유와 해결 방법에 대해 토론

MySQL이 내부 명령이 아닌 이유와 해결 방법에 대해 토론

PHPz
PHPz원래의
2023-04-19 14:16:144741검색

MySQL은 매우 인기 있는 오픈 소스 관계형 데이터베이스 관리 시스템이며, 많은 웹 애플리케이션은 MySQL을 백엔드 데이터베이스로 사용합니다. 그러나 사용자가 MySQL을 사용하려고 하면 "mysql이 내부 또는 외부 명령, 실행 가능한 프로그램 또는 배치 파일로 인식되지 않습니다."라는 오류가 자주 발생합니다. 이러한 상황은 혼란스러울 수 있지만 몇 가지 해결 방법을 따르면 이를 해결할 수 있습니다. 그것.

  1. MySQL 설치

MySQL이 내부 명령이 아닌 가장 일반적인 이유는 사용자가 MySQL을 설치하지 않았거나 MySQL의 설치 경로가 시스템 환경 변수에 추가되지 않았기 때문입니다. 이 경우 MySQL 공식 웹사이트에서 MySQL을 다운로드하여 설치한 후 시스템 환경 변수에 MySQL 설치 경로를 추가하기만 하면 됩니다.

  1. 환경 변수 확인

MySQL을 설치했지만 "MySQL은 내부 명령이 아닙니다"라는 오류가 계속 발생하는 경우 시스템 환경 변수를 확인해야 합니다. MySQL의 설치 경로가 시스템의 Path 변수에 추가되었는지 확인해야 합니다. 다음 단계를 수행할 수 있습니다.

a 컴퓨터 아이콘을 마우스 오른쪽 버튼으로 클릭하고 속성을 선택합니다.

b. "고급 시스템 설정" 창에서 "환경 변수" 버튼을 클릭하세요.

c. "시스템 변수" 섹션에서 MySQL 경로가 포함된 "Path" 변수를 찾아 MySQL 경로가 목록에 포함되어 있는지 확인하세요.

  1. MySQL 서비스가 실행 중인지 확인하세요

MySQL 설치 경로가 시스템 환경 변수에 추가되었지만 여전히 "mysql은 내부 명령이 아닙니다" 문제가 발생하는 경우 MySQL 서비스가 실행되지 않습니다. 다음 단계에 따라 MySQL 서비스가 실행 중인지 확인할 수 있습니다.

a. "서비스" 애플리케이션을 엽니다. Windows 검색창에 "services.msc"를 입력하여 열 수 있습니다.

b. "서비스" 목록에서 MySQL 서비스를 찾아 MySQL 서비스가 실행 중인지 확인하세요. MySQL 서비스가 시작되지 않은 경우 서비스 이름을 클릭한 후 "시작" 버튼을 클릭하세요.

  1. MySQL 설치 디렉터리 확인

MySQL 설치 디렉터리에 필요한 파일이 누락된 경우 "MySQL은 내부 명령이 아닙니다."라는 오류가 발생할 수 있습니다. 이 경우 MySQL 설치 디렉터리에

a.mysql.exe

b.mysqld.exe

c.libmysql.dll

파일이 없는지 확인해야 합니다. , MySQL을 다시 설치하거나 MySQL이 설치된 다른 컴퓨터에서 해당 파일을 복사해야 합니다.

  1. MySQL 환경 변수 구성

MySQL 설치 경로가 시스템 환경 변수에 추가되었지만 여전히 mysql 명령을 실행할 수 없는 경우 "MYSQL_HOME"이라는 새 환경 변수를 수동으로 정의하고 설정해야 할 수도 있습니다. value MySQL 설치 경로입니다. 마찬가지로 MySQL 설치 경로를 시스템의 Path 변수에 추가해야 합니다.

요약

위는 "mysql이 내부 명령이 아닙니다"를 해결하는 방법입니다. MySQL을 사용할 때 MySQL이 올바르게 설치되었는지, 해당 경로가 시스템 환경 변수에 추가되었는지, MySQL 서비스가 실행되고 있는지 확인해야 합니다. 그래도 문제가 발생하면 MySQL 설치 디렉터리 확인, MySQL 환경 변수 구성 등을 통해 문제를 해결할 수 있습니다.

위 내용은 MySQL이 내부 명령이 아닌 이유와 해결 방법에 대해 토론의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.